Fighting between sworn enemies Armenia and Azerbaijan resumed earlier on Sunday, with each country blaming the other for starting hostilities over Nagorno-Karabakh. Armenia said Azerbaijan’s forces shelled the breakaway region and inflicted civilian casualties, while Baku accused Armenian troops of hitting military and civilian targets as well. Meanwhile, Nagorno-Karabakh – a predominantly Armenian-populated region that fought a war of independence against Azerbaijan in the 1990s – has declared martial law and issued a total conscription call for all men older than 18.Russia's foreign ministry, a mediator in decades of conflict between majority Christian Armenia and mainly Muslim Azerbaijan, urged both sides to cease fire immediately and hold talks. The two countries have long been at odds over Nagorno-Karabakh, which broke away from Azerbaijan in a conflict that broke out as the Soviet Union collapsed.

Rochester police has announced its first ever female police chief after the city's entire command staff quit following protests over the cop killing of Daniel Prude. Cynthia Herriott-Sullivan, a former lieutenant with the Rochester Police Department, was appointed to the role of interim chief of the addled force Saturday morning. Mayor Lovely Warren announced her appointment in a press conference at City Hall where she said Herriott-Sullivan is the right person to mend fractured relations between the community and police department and bring about much-needed changes to law enforcement in the city. This came after Warren fired former chief Le'Ron Singletary last week after he and several senior members of the force stood down en masse following a backlash over Prude's death. Outrage erupted earlier this month when footage surfaced of black man Prude, who was suffering mental health issues, being suffocated by police officers in the streets of Rochester, New York, nearly six months ago.
